Crosswalk Community Church: A Progressive Alternative

Loren Haas My wife and I have been members for 15 years. If you expect church to be narrow minded, legalistic and to worship the Bible you will be surprised that CrossWalk checks none of those boxes. While the oldest Baptist church in Napa, (American Baptist, as in MLKs affiliation) founded in 1860, it is not stuck defending antiquated culture. It is egalitarian with women in pastoral roles, leadership and teaching positions. It is LGBTQ welcoming and fully affirming with members of that community participating in leadership. We also have outstanding teaching from toddlers through Middle School. Pastor Peter Shaws teaching is intellectually challenging but emphasizes spiritual and meditative practices as well. It is a very relaxed, come as you are atmosphere full of real people. People of other faith practices are welcome here. Services at 9 and 10 AM. We believe following Jesus also means serving the community in a sacrificial way. We host 40+ recovery groups on a weekly basis. Our parking lot is almost always busy. We operate a food pantry and supply food and cooking essentials to people moving off the street and into safe housing. We also work with other churches to feed unhoused people in Napa on the weekend. We provide space on our large campus for non-profits such as citizenship clinics and immigration legal aid. Our gym is used by schools, clubs and sports leagues. Crosswalk is the first Emergency shelter to open and the last to close. Fifteen minutes and we can open the doors. During the recent earthquake and fires we housed evacuees and were an information hub. We are currently remodeling our large but antiquated kitchen to modern standards so as to be able to provide meals. The bathrooms and gym showers have been upgraded to ADA standards to better serve everyone. Come experience CrossWalk. Instead of higher walls, we make bigger tables.
